Output 6588917644c475ca5894685ad08693a7517c8dbeba970a064162c33f79298dd3:0

value
1262187
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d552ed3c7fff216c4e059a2a7595590f2670cd04 OP_EQUALVERIFY OP_CHECKSIG
address
1LSxGi5mUJqHCwue4mrH27ZdHEkhhHQNcw
transaction
6588917644c475ca5894685ad08693a7517c8dbeba970a064162c33f79298dd3
spent
true